Haptoglobin

Diagnostic Use

Haptoglobin is decreased in haemolysis from any cause.

Haptoglobin binds circulating haemoglobin and the complex is cleared from the plasma by the liver.

Low levels of haptoglobin are common in newborns (less than 3 months).
